This is a small batch recipe, designed to serve 2 to 3 people. Low in fat, it is quick and easy to make and oh-so-delicious! You can also make this tasty soup ahead of time, simply reheating when you want to eat. You may need to add a bit more chicken stock in that case.

Ingredients and spices that need to be Get to make Bow-Tie Carrot Chicken Noodle Soup:

  1. 225 gm bowtie
  2. 1 small stick of celery, trimmed and chopped (about 1/2 cup)
  3. 1 small onion, peeled and chopped (about 1/2 cup)
  4. 1 tbs butter
  5. 1/2 medium carrot, peeled and sliced
  6. pinch salt
  7. as taste black pepper
  8. 2 cups (480 ml) chicken stock
  9. 1/2 tsp dried basil
  10. 1/2 cup shredded or cubed cooked chicken breast meat
  11. 3/4 cup (85 g) dry pasta or noodles
  12. 1/2 tsp dried parsley
  13. 1/2 tsp dried oregano

Steps to make Bow-Tie Carrot Chicken Noodle Soup

  1. Melt the butter in a medium saucepan. Add the vegetables. Cook over medium low heat, stirring occasionally, until beginning to soften, about 5 minutes.Add the chicken stock, carrot, bowtie, herbs and season to taste with salt and black pepper. Bring to the boil, then reduce to a simmer. Simmer for 10 minutes.
  2. Add the noodles/pasta. Simmer for a further 10 minutes or so, until the pasta has softened to al dente, stirring occasionally. Stir in the chicken and heat through. Taste and adjust seasoning as desired. Serve hot.
